Zalopay, Software Engineer
1 week ago
The
- **Core**
**Payment** is the heart of ZaloPay, serves as the central component of ZaloPay, one of leading e-wallet platforms in Vietnam. Our primary responsibility is to handle various transaction processes and manage the fund flows, encompassing activities such as top-ups, withdrawals, transfers, and payments. With a focus on meeting stringent technical requirements, our system ensures a seamless and secure payment experience by delivering exceptional performance in terms of throughput, latency, availability, and scalability.
Additionally, our team extends support to critical financial domains, actively contributing to the development of high-performance services and financial products dedicated to accounting, finance, and business operations. Through our efforts, ZaloPay can provide instant money transfers, expedited operations, and top-level security measures. As a result, we play a crucial role in ZaloPay's commitment to advancing a cashless society, delivering a wide range of services and enticing offers to our users.
**Responsibilities (You will)**
- Design, build, and maintain large-scale services, data pipelines, tooling, and systems to ensure a direct business impact in ZaloPay’s mission-critical business domains including Product, Merchant, Accounting, Finance, and Business Operations.
- Write clean, efficient, and well-documented code using best practices.
- Debug and resolve complex issues that may arise in the system and address performance bottlenecks.
- Collaborate with cross-functional teams, including product managers, designers, and other engineers to define requirements and deliver high-quality solutions.
- Keep up-to-date with the latest technologies and trends in the industry and identify opportunities for improvement.
- Work in an Agile & collaborative environment involving different stakeholders.
- Able to work in a high-pressure environment.
**Yêu cầu**:
-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field.
- Have experience with distributed transaction algorithms such as TCC, SAGA, Two-Phase Commit.
- Extensive experience working with databases, including SQL and NoSQL systems.
- In-depth knowledge of database design principles and performance optimization techniques.
- Strong understanding of consensus algorithms, such as Paxos, Raft, or Practical Byzantine Fault Tolerance (PBFT).
- Have experience with distributed caching such as Redis, distributed locking such as ZooKeeper, and distributed event streaming platforms such as Kafka.
- Write high-quality & maintainable codes. We work mostly in Java. However, languages are tools and we care more about your mindset & general engineering skills.
- Have implemented and delivered distributed systems on a large scale.
- Have experience in tracing system problems.
**The following skills would be nice to have**
- Experience with Java technologies: Spring Boot, Reactive Programming, Concurrent/Parallel Programming, Messaging Frameworks,...
- Experience with big-data technologies such as Apache Kafka, Apache Spark, Presto, Apache Flink, and OLAP.
- Experience in optimizing JVM.
- Experience with financial-related platforms/products is a plus.
- Knowing how to work with K8S or cloud services, e.g GCP, AWS... is a big plus.
**Why choosing us**
- At ZaloPay, we develop the CORE transaction processing in-house. We have created a system that can effectively serve the Vietnamese market on a daily basis as well as during high-volume periods such as Tet, holiday, promotion campaign... Our system is scalable, highly available, secure, and can handle a large volume of transactions efficiently while ensuring accuracy and the safety of funds.
- Payment Engine is a high-performing team with team morale high and everyone is happy. We are promoting a positive, innovative, and productive work environment, fostering cross-functional collaboration, and promoting continuous learning and improvement.
-
Software Engineer, Zalopay
1 week ago
Ho Chi Minh City, Vietnam VNG Full time**Trust & Safety team** at ZaloPay gather highly motivated team players who dedicate in building ZaloPay as the most trusted e-wallet and best against to bad actors in Vietnam fintech market. By developing and adapting advanced tech-driven prevention mechanisms/solutions while focusing on the user growth and customer experience, we aim to make risk...
-
Zalopay, Senior Software Engineer
2 weeks ago
Ho Chi Minh City, Vietnam VNG Full time**Trust & Safety** team at ZaloPay gather highly motivated team players who dedicate in building ZaloPay as the most trusted e-wallet and best against to bad actors in Vietnam fintech market. By developing and adapting advanced tech-driven prevention mechanisms/solutions while focusing on the user growth and customer experience, we aim to make risk...
-
Zalopay, Senior Software Engineer
2 weeks ago
Ho Chi Minh City, Vietnam VNG Full timeBuild mission-critical backend service that deliver value to ZaloPay Core Systems. You will help develop and operate high performance, scalable, reliable and resilient core ZaloPay software systems and libraries. - Troubleshoot and debug technical issues inside a deep and most complex technical stack that includes micro services, monoliths, containers and...
-
Senior Software Engineer
2 weeks ago
Ho Chi Minh City, Vietnam VNG Full timeThe Payment Core is the heart of ZaloPay, serves as the central component of ZaloPay, one of leading e-wallet platforms in Vietnam. Our primary responsibility is to handle various transaction processes and manage the fund flows, encompassing activities such as top-ups, withdrawals, transfers, and payments. With a focus on meeting stringent technical...
-
Software Engineer
2 weeks ago
Ho Chi Minh City, Vietnam VNG Full time**Payment Engine (PE) **is the heart of ZaloPay. The module specializes in transaction processing and fund flows. We are processing all kind of transaction in ZaloPay. The system supports various types of transactions (topup, withdrawal, money transfer, payment,...). The main technical requirements of the system are to provide high throughput (3k TPS), low...
-
Zalopay, Senior Software Engineer
3 days ago
Ho Chi Minh City, Vietnam công ty cổ phần vng Full timeXem và nộp hồ sơ ngay **Lưu ý**: - Người tìm việc đang xem tin **ZaloPay, Senior Software Engineer (Java)**: - **Mã tin đăng: 3451762**. Mọi thông tin liên quan tới tin tuyển dụng này là do người đăng tin đăng tải và chịu trách nhiệm. Chúng tôi luôn cố gắng để có chất lượng thông tin tốt...
-
Associate Software Engineer
3 days ago
Thành phố Hồ Chí Minh, Vietnam VNG Full timeBuild mission-critical backend service that delivers value to Zalopay core System. You will help develop and operate high-performance, scalable, reliable, and resilient core Zalopay software systems, and libraries. - Troubleshoot and debug technical issues inside a deep and complex technical stack that includes microservices, modular monoliths, and...
-
Zalopay, Staff Software Engineer
2 weeks ago
Ho Chi Minh City, Vietnam VNG Full timePayment Engine (PE) is the heart of ZaloPay. The module specializes in transaction processing and fund flows. Technically, it is a Distributed Transaction Coordinator. The system supports various types of transactions (topup, withdrawal, money transfer, payment,...). The main technical requirements of the system are to provide high throughput (3k TPS), low...
-
Zalopay, Senior Software Engineer I
2 weeks ago
Ho Chi Minh City, Vietnam VNG Full timeThe Accounting Engineering team is at the core of ZaloPay to empower mission-critical financial domains including Accounting, Finance and Business Operations. Engineers on the Accounting Engineering team build high-performant services, resilient data pipelines, and financial products for the Finance team led by ZaloPay’s CFO. The use cases include...
-
Zalopay, Software Engineer
2 weeks ago
Ho Chi Minh City, Vietnam VNG Full timePayment Engine (PE) is the heart of ZaloPay. The module specializes in transaction processing and fund flows. Technically, it is a Distributed Transaction Coordinator. The system supports various types of transactions (topup, withdrawal, money transfer, payment,...). The main technical requirements of the system are to provide high throughput (3k TPS), low...
-
Zalopay, Senior Software Engineer
1 week ago
Ho Chi Minh City, Vietnam VNG Full timeThe - **Core Payment team** is the heart of ZaloPay, serves as the central component of ZaloPay, one of leading e-wallet platforms in Vietnam. Our primary responsibility is to handle various transaction processes and manage the fund flows, encompassing activities such as top-ups, withdrawals, transfers, and payments. With a focus on meeting stringent...
-
Zalopay, Staff Software Engineer
1 week ago
Ho Chi Minh City, Vietnam VNG Full timeStaff Software Engineer participate in designing and building Financial products for ZaloPay (Saving account, BNPL, Stock Trading ) Research, assess, and adopt new technologies as required. Actively participate in writing unit tests, and automation tests to maintain high-quality deliveries. Collaborate with stakeholders across teams and roles, to identify...
-
Zalopay, Mobile Software Engineer
1 week ago
Ho Chi Minh City, Vietnam VNG Full timeParticipate in the Agile software development model, developing features to enhance the banking experience for users of ZaloPay; - Implement new ideas for products; - Opportunities to work and develop skills in backend development. **Yêu cầu**: - 2+ years of experience in iOS developer role; - Smart, eager to learn and passionate about create products...
-
Zalopay, Staff Software Engineer
2 weeks ago
Ho Chi Minh City, Vietnam VNG Full timeParticipate in designing and building Financial products for ZaloPay (Saving account, BNPL, Stock Trading) - Research, assess, and adopt new technologies as required. - Actively participate in writing unit tests, and automation tests to maintain high-quality deliveries. - Collaborate with stakeholders across teams and roles, to identify and resolve...
-
Zalopay, Senior Software Engineer
1 week ago
Ho Chi Minh City, Vietnam VNG Full timeBack End (Java) engineers at ZaloPay build the microservices powering our promotions systems that reach millions of users. You will build microservices primarily with Spring Boot, Kafka, Redis and various SQL and NoSQL database systems. With 3 different sub-domains, promotions projects range from a few weeks for R&D to large ongoing systems development. You...
-
Zalopay, Senior Data Engineer
2 weeks ago
Ho Chi Minh City, Vietnam VNG Corporation Full time**ZaloPay, Senior Data Engineer**: VNG Corporation - Ứng Tuyển Database Python Agile - Đăng nhập để xem mức lương - VNG Campus, Tân Thuận Đông, District 7, Ho Chi Minh- Xem bản đồ- Tại văn phòng- 1 giờ trước **3 Lý Do Để Gia Nhập Công Ty**: - Attractive salary & benefits you'll love - Building large-scale...
-
Zalopay - Senior Site Reliability Engineer
1 week ago
Ho Chi Minh City, Vietnam VNG Full timeAs SRE, you will: - Build, plan and support ZaloPay Infrastructure, give support around physical and cloud resources, operate ZaloPay services, do asset inventory, make sure system runs smoothly with minimum downtime across environment; - Roll and maintain Disaster Recovery System; - Support developer engineers to deploy changes to production. Manage,...
-
Zalopay, Software Engineer
2 weeks ago
Ho Chi Minh City, Vietnam VNG Full timeParticipate in designing and building Financial Services products for ZaloPay. - Work with Product development team to plan new features, gather requirements and suggest solutions. - Tracking and monitoring product metrics to get fast feedback from end users. - Actively participate in writing unit tests, automation tests to maintain high quality...
-
Zalopay, Senior Data Engineer
2 weeks ago
Ho Chi Minh City, Vietnam VNG Full timeThe Accounting Engineering team is at the core of ZaloPay to empower mission-critical financial domains including Accounting, Finance and Business Operations. Engineers on the Accounting Engineering team build high-performant services, resilient data pipelines, and financial products for the Finance team led by ZaloPay’s CFO. The use cases include...
-
Senior Site Reliability Engineer Ii, Zalopay
2 weeks ago
Ho Chi Minh City, Vietnam VNG Full timeBuild, plan and support ZaloPay Infrastructure, give support around physical and cloud resources, operate ZaloPay services, do asset inventory, make sure system runs smoothly with minimum downtime across environment; - Roll and maintain Disaster Recovery System; - Support developer engineers to deploy changes to production. Manage, operate, update system...